Details Value
Brand Spectrum Filaments
Product Line PLA Nature
Material PLA with natural bio-filler
Variant Pils Beer
Filament Diameter 1.75mm
Diameter Tolerance ±0.03mm
Net Weight 1kg
Density 1.25 g/cm³
Surface Finish Semi-matte / natural textured finish
Nozzle Temperature 185–215°C
Bed Temperature 0–45°C
Recommended Print Speed 40–150 mm/s
Cooling Fan Up to 100%
Heated Chamber Not Required
Filament Dryer Required No
Hardened Nozzle Required No
Adhesive Required Not required
Heat Resistance Up to 60°C
RoHS & REACH Compliant Yes
AMS Compatibility Yes
Packaging Vacuum sealed with moisture absorber

What makes Spectrum PLA Nature Pils Beer different from standard PLA?

Spectrum PLA Nature Pils Beer contains natural brewery-derived bio-fillers that create a unique texture and appearance while maintaining the easy printability associated with traditional PLA filament.


Is Spectrum PLA Nature Pils Beer easy to print?

Yes. The material is designed to print using standard PLA settings and offers low shrinkage, reliable bed adhesion, and consistent printing performance on most FDM 3D printers.


Do I need a hardened nozzle to print this filament?

No. Spectrum PLA Nature Pils Beer is formulated for use with standard nozzles, and a hardened nozzle is not required under normal printing conditions.


What printers are compatible with this filament?

The filament is compatible with most 1.75mm FDM/FFF 3D printers, including machines from Bambu Lab, Creality, Prusa, Anycubic, Elegoo, FlashForge, Raise3D, and many other popular brands.


What types of projects is this filament best suited for?

It is ideal for decorative models, educational projects, architectural concepts, product prototypes, interior design pieces, artistic creations, and presentation models that benefit from a natural-looking finish.


Does this filament require a heated bed?

A heated bed is optional. Recommended bed temperatures range from 0°C to 45°C, depending on your printer and build surface.


Can printed parts withstand heat?

The material offers heat resistance up to approximately 60°C, and post-print heat treatment may further improve thermal performance for certain applications.


How should I store Spectrum PLA Nature Pils Beer filament?

Store the filament in a cool, dry environment and keep it sealed when not in use to maintain optimal print quality and minimize moisture absorption.
